Nachos with cheese and ground beef originate from Mexican cuisine, known for their flavorful and hearty combination of textures and ingredients. This dish typically includes tortilla chips topped with seasoned ground beef, melted cheese, and optional toppings like jalapeños, guacamole, sour cream, and salsa. It is a calorie-dense meal, rich in proteins and fats from the ground beef and cheese, and carbohydrates from the tortilla chips. A typical serving can provide approximately 300-500 calories, with significant contributions of protein (12-20g) and fats (15-25g), depending on portion size and preparation methods. It is also a source of calcium, zinc, and iron, found in cheese and beef respectively, but may also contain high levels of sodium and saturated fats, so moderation is important for a balanced diet.
Store cooked ground beef and cheese separately in airtight containers in the refrigerator for up to 3-4 days. Reheat thoroughly before serving. Avoid storing pre-assembled nachos as the chips can become soggy.
Yes, Nachos With Cheese And Ground Beef are a good source of protein due to the cheese and ground beef. A typical serving (about 1 cup) contains approximately 15-20 grams of protein, depending on the portion size and type of ingredients used.
Nachos With Cheese And Ground Beef can be modified to fit a keto diet by using low-carb tortilla chips and focusing on high-fat toppings like cheese, ground beef, and sour cream. Traditional nachos with regular chips are higher in carbs and may not be suitable for strict keto guidelines.
Nachos With Cheese And Ground Beef can provide nutrients like protein, calcium, and iron, but they are often high in calories, saturated fat, and sodium. Moderation is key, and healthier preparation methods, such as using baked chips and lean ground beef, can make them a better option.
A recommended portion size for Nachos With Cheese And Ground Beef is roughly 1 cup or about 5-8 chips with toppings. This portion provides around 250-350 calories depending on the specific ingredients, making it a reasonable snack or side dish.
Nachos With Cheese And Ground Beef contain more protein but are higher in saturated fat compared to vegetarian nachos, which often use toppings like beans, vegetables, and plant-based cheese. Vegetarian options may be lower in calories and provide more fiber per serving.
